If you’re looking to give your garden a real boost this spring then an organic seaweed plant tonic like Seasol is just what you’re looking for.
- One of the things it’s really good for is reducing transplant shock, it helps ease plants into their new home and get them off to a flying start by promoting a strong healthy root growth.
- It stimulates beneficial soil micro-organisms which create rich, living soil.
- It’s good for preparing your plants warm days ahead, toughening plants from the inside out and helps to make them more resilient to heat and drought.
- Plants treated regularly are slower to wilt in the heat and stand up better to dry conditions – so you get a stunning looking garden even through the hotter months.
